Corteiz: How a UK Streetwear Brand Emerged

From humble beginnings operating out of a shed in London, Corteiz has rapidly become a dominant force in the UK youth clothing scene. What started as a passion project founded by Jacob and Finley, the brand quickly gained a dedicated following thanks to its distinctive aesthetic, characterized by bold graphics, oversized silhouettes, and a unique blend of athletic wear and everyday apparel. Their initial attention on limited-edition drops and a strong online presence fueled initial buzz, attracting a loyal customer base eager to secure pieces. The brand’s clever promotion tactics, often incorporating community engagement and a sense of exclusivity, have been instrumental in cultivating a powerful brand identity, propelling Corteiz beyond a local phenomenon to a nationally recognized name, with eyes now firmly set on global expansion.

Unraveling Corteiz Style: Decoding the Capsule Collection

The buzz around Corteiz has been substantial, largely fueled by their unique and instantly recognizable aesthetic. Their capsule collections aren't just clothing; they're a statement, a carefully constructed narrative that resonates particularly well with a younger, digitally native audience. At the heart of Corteiz lies a blend of utilitarian design, often inspired by workwear and military apparel, layered with more info a distinctly European, almost Brutalist, visual sensibility. You're likely to see heavy use of oversized silhouettes, muted color palettes – think earthy tones and deep blacks – punctuated by unexpected pops of bright color, almost like a glitch in the matrix. The brand frequently employs graphic elements and typography that feel simultaneously raw and refined, adding another layer of complexity to the overall feel. This isn’t about fleeting trends; it’s about a sustained approach to creating pieces that are both functional and visually arresting, encouraging individuality and a considered personal expression. The limited releases and carefully curated drops only amplify the feeling of exclusivity and desirability that defines the Corteiz brand.
